I intend to trek up mt kilimanjaro next year, to raise money for Give a Child a Chance. Has anyone done this already and if so could you give me some advise please.

did marangu route 1st week of oct. very easy trail, no difficulties til I hit above 15,400 ft. as i did not take diamox. I did make it to summit, but hurried back down. everyone else in party that took diamox had shortness of breath, but no hallucinations or nausea such as myself.
very much worth it and i would do it again.
the mountain is beyond beautiful
